欢迎来到天天文库
浏览记录
ID:56280485
大小:26.50 KB
页数:3页
时间:2020-06-05
《用C语言实现牛顿向前插值计算.doc》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、用C语言实现牛顿向前插值计算,程序代码如下:#include"stdlib.h"#include"stdio.h"#include"conio.h"#include"string.h"#include"math.h"#defineN100typedefstruct{floatx;floaty;}POINT;floatCreTable(intn,POINTTable[N],floaty[N][N]){inti,j,count=0;for(i=0;i2、,i+1);scanf("%f,%f",&Table[i].x,&Table[i].y);}for(i=0;i3、(i=0;i4、+){printf("Inputx0[%d]:",j+1);scanf("%f",&a[j]);printf("Inputx[%d]:",j+1);scanf("%f",&x[j]);printf("Inputh[%d]:",j+1);scanf("%f",&h[j]);t[j]=(x[j]-a[j])/h[j];printf("t[%d]=%.5f",j+1,t[j]);for(i=0;i5、j=0;j6、f("%d",&n);CreTable(n,Table,y);ShowTable(n,Table,y);Calculus(n,Table,y);getch();}
2、,i+1);scanf("%f,%f",&Table[i].x,&Table[i].y);}for(i=0;i3、(i=0;i4、+){printf("Inputx0[%d]:",j+1);scanf("%f",&a[j]);printf("Inputx[%d]:",j+1);scanf("%f",&x[j]);printf("Inputh[%d]:",j+1);scanf("%f",&h[j]);t[j]=(x[j]-a[j])/h[j];printf("t[%d]=%.5f",j+1,t[j]);for(i=0;i5、j=0;j6、f("%d",&n);CreTable(n,Table,y);ShowTable(n,Table,y);Calculus(n,Table,y);getch();}
3、(i=0;i4、+){printf("Inputx0[%d]:",j+1);scanf("%f",&a[j]);printf("Inputx[%d]:",j+1);scanf("%f",&x[j]);printf("Inputh[%d]:",j+1);scanf("%f",&h[j]);t[j]=(x[j]-a[j])/h[j];printf("t[%d]=%.5f",j+1,t[j]);for(i=0;i5、j=0;j6、f("%d",&n);CreTable(n,Table,y);ShowTable(n,Table,y);Calculus(n,Table,y);getch();}
4、+){printf("Inputx0[%d]:",j+1);scanf("%f",&a[j]);printf("Inputx[%d]:",j+1);scanf("%f",&x[j]);printf("Inputh[%d]:",j+1);scanf("%f",&h[j]);t[j]=(x[j]-a[j])/h[j];printf("t[%d]=%.5f",j+1,t[j]);for(i=0;i5、j=0;j6、f("%d",&n);CreTable(n,Table,y);ShowTable(n,Table,y);Calculus(n,Table,y);getch();}
5、j=0;j6、f("%d",&n);CreTable(n,Table,y);ShowTable(n,Table,y);Calculus(n,Table,y);getch();}
6、f("%d",&n);CreTable(n,Table,y);ShowTable(n,Table,y);Calculus(n,Table,y);getch();}
此文档下载收益归作者所有